Watched it tonight. Have to give it a NO as far as the film is concerned. I sometimes wondered what the heck did I just watch? I admit not being familiar with the graphic novel, then again I was unfamiliar with X-MEN when I saw that and loved it!! I just didn't find the characters or story compelling.

I'm not a fan of the stylized picture. I felt there were moments when we were robbed of the finest detail, however it was a fairly sharp picture, however I think that 300 had more fine detail than this film and that one was intentionally grainy. However i'll accept that the film is suppose to look that way and so no major issues.

I'm glad i'm not the only one who had to keep turning their volume knob up about 5dbs over my standard for DTSMA. I'm betting that Warner actually used the non-default dialnorm setting as i've never had to raise a DTSMA track this high before! However once I got a good level, the soundtrack had lots of punch. While the sounds can be very aggressive at times, i'm suprised by the lack of discrete effects and panning in this film. While well recorded, it didn't display the finest of detail to rank it as reference. However I will say that no one will be disappointed with this track.
